I've had this disc for a number of years. But finally decided to catalog my bag. I probably found the disc, and it had no markings to speak-of. This was before the days where they had lost & found drop-offs.

This disc is marked "2010 PHILLY OPEN" The symbol looks a little like the Lattitude logo, but not quite. (Not sure Lattitude existed back then?!) I guess it could be John-Doe off brand that they awarded to the winner(s), or maybe they just gave them out to every participant. But either option seems odd since, it wouldn't be PDGA approved that way. I suppose the markings on what disc its really supposed to be could have just been rubbed off. The under-side says it was resold and/or sold for $7.99 at a shop. No helpful info on that side to speak-of, except I think the weight.

It feels like a high-speed distance driver, with a thick lip. But I actually have not thrown it much. So it remains mysterious. I probably should have given it more attention.

Do manufacturers other than Innova allow you to buy the misprints when they get run? I don't recall having that option with anyone else but I also barely recall my breakfast. My guess is Innova something-or-other in pro plastic based on the limited info at hand.

Prodigy, MVP/Axiom, Discraft, and DD/Lat/Wside (in addition to Innova, of course) misprints regularly show up at PIAS in the Raleigh, Durham, Cary, and Holy Springs (same ownership), and although there's (apparently) nothing currently in stock, I've purchased misprints from various mfgs on Infinite Discs Misprints page.
